Quantifying Adaptive Evolution of the Human Immune Cell Landscape
2023-10-06
Abstract excerpt
The human immune system is under constant evolutionary pressure, primarily through its role as first line of defence against pathogens. Accordingly, population genomics studies have shown that immune-related genes have a high rate of adaptive evolution. These studies, however, are mainly based on protein-coding genes without cellular context, leaving the adaptive role of cell types and states uncharted. Inferring...
